In Argentina, while the country has been confined again since Friday, a caravan of indigenous women arrived in Buenos Aires on Saturday.
They came on foot from all over the country to denounce the destruction of ecosystems in their territories.

With our correspondent in Buenos Aires,
Théo Conscience
Their journey ends in the pouring rain.
After two and a half months of travel and almost 2,000 kilometers on foot, members of the Indigenous Women's Movement for Good Living, representing
26 indigenous peoples
, finally arrive in Buenos Aires.
They bring with them an offering, medicinal plants from their territories, which they burn to cure the ills of society.
“
In these times of systemic crisis, we must find a harmonious relationship with nature.
Promote ancestral medicine.
Because we will not be able to produce a vaccine against 'terricide',
”says one of them.
"
Extractivism is killing us
"
This "
terricide
" that they denounce is
the systematic aggression of nature
, the fires which ravage Patagonia, the desertification of soils due to intensive agriculture, or the major mining projects which destroy ecosystems and affect their spiritual life.
Briseida Lejo came from the province of Santa Fé, in the north of the country.
“
Despite the pandemic, we had to mobilize because we are also experiencing a humanitarian emergency.
The
extractivism
is killing us
, "she testifies.
In conclusion, they sing a traditional song in chorus.
Tears in their eyes, tight against each other, they promise to come back even more next year.
